I'm considering solar. Should I get traditional panels or wait for solar shingles?

With the 30% federal Investment Tax Credit and Ohio's net metering policies, solar is financially viable. For a home needing a re-roof now, the most pragmatic path is installing a new, high-quality architectural shingle roof designed for later solar-panel attachment. Integrated solar shingles in 2026 remain a premium product with higher cost-per-watt; they are best for new construction or roofs with 15+ years of life remaining, not for a 70-year-old system at its end.

My homeowner's insurance premium just went up again. Can my roof really help lower the cost?

Yes, proactively upgrading your roof is one of the few ways to directly combat the 14% average premium trend in Ohio. Installing a roof that meets the voluntary IBHS FORTIFIED Home standard can qualify you for significant insurance credits. This is because insurers recognize these roofs are far less likely to sustain catastrophic storm damage, making your home a lower financial risk for them to insure over the long term.

What are the current code requirements for a roof replacement in Duncan Falls?

All work permitted through the Muskingum County Building Department must comply with the 2024 Ohio Residential Code. For a contractor licensed by the Ohio Construction Industry Licensing Board, this now mandates specific ice and water shield coverage extending 24 inches inside the interior wall line, not just at the eaves. Flashing details for walls, chimneys, and valleys are also more stringent to manage the high wind-driven rain we experience, ensuring long-term weathertightness.

I have mold in my attic but no roof leaks. How is that possible?

This is a classic sign of improper ventilation, which is common on standard 8/12 gable roofs. The 2024 IRC requires a balanced system of intake (typically at the soffits) and exhaust (at or near the ridge). When this balance is off, warm, moist air from the house becomes trapped in the attic during winter, condensing on the cold underside of the roof sheathing and leading to mold growth on the wood decking and structural framing.

My roof looks a bit tired and I've noticed some granules in the gutters. Is it just normal aging?

Roofs in Duncan Falls Central with original 1956-era construction are at a critical age. A 70-year-old architectural asphalt shingle system over 1x6 pine plank decking is at the end of its service life. The pine planks expand and contract with moisture, while the asphalt shingles become brittle from decades of UV exposure. This combination leads to cracking, granule loss, and a high risk of leaks that can damage the historic decking underneath.

With all the severe thunderstorms we get, what makes a roof truly storm-resistant?

True storm resistance for our 115 mph wind zone requires a systems approach beyond just shingles. It starts with proper deck attachment to the rafters. For hail, specifying Class 4 impact-rated shingles is a financial necessity given our moderate hail risk; they withstand 2-inch impacts and are increasingly required for insurance discounts. Integrating these with enhanced leak barriers at eaves and rakes creates a unified assembly that performs during the May-July peak storm season.
